## Deployment

Release managers should deploy Till & Tally's payment service only after the integration suite passes twice consecutively; the gateway-simulator tests are known to flake under load, and a single green run is not sufficient evidence. Always deploy during the low-traffic window and verify the canary before promoting. The deployment job reads the following configuration.

deployment values, kajep-kageg:
[praix]
host = praix.paliqcorp.corp
user = praix_svc
database = praix_prod

Handover note — Marek to Ilsa (cc: reviewer)

The branch replaces our homegrown Pellworth job queue with the new Straywick broker. Please review the migration shim carefully: it dual-writes jobs for one release cycle so we can roll back without losing work. Retry semantics changed from fixed backoff to jittered exponential, and the dead-letter table is now append-only. All old queue tables stay read-only until the shim is removed. The staging credentials vault is sealed; unseal it with the passphrase below.

vault phrase of kawep-tahog = ulaix-briath

Attendees: G. Farrow (chair), L. Okonde, P. Strand, M. Veil.

The group reviewed the proposal to shift Cloverdeck subscriptions from monthly to annual billing. Finance modelled a short-term cash dip offset by stronger retention; Sales flagged pushback risk from smaller accounts in the Darrowmere region. Agreed: pilot with renewals only, starting next quarter, with a 10% annual discount cap. Full rollout decision deferred pending pilot data. Board members should note the sensitive item recorded immediately below.

board note of bawep-tajef: Queniusek Systems plans to raise the Quenvan list price by 53.1 percent in March. The pricing group signed off on a budget of $176.4 million for Project Drueth. The renewal with Casionix Partners closes at $142.5 million a year, 8.3 percent below the last contract. Project Fraax slips by six weeks because of the tooling delay.

## Ownership

This directory contains the migration from our homegrown job queue (`forgequeue`) to the Lanternwick broker. The old queue remains in read-only drain mode until all producers are cut over; do not delete its tables. Reviewers should treat any change touching `forgequeue/compat/` as high-risk and require a second approval. All architectural decisions, cutover scheduling, and rollback calls for this migration are made by a single owner.

account owner for bawip-tahag: Raleth Quenok